Warning Signs You Need Trim & Baseboard Replacement After Water Damage
Catching water damage to your trim and baseboards early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show water damage to your trim and baseboards. Don’t ignore these smells as they can lead to mold growth and health hazards.
Warped or Discolored Trim and Baseboards
Warped or discolored trim and baseboards can be a sign of water damage. Check for signs of buckling or warping and address the issue quickly.
Water Stains or Mineral Deposits
Water stains or mineral deposits on your walls or ceiling can show water damage to your trim and baseboards. Check for signs of discoloration or mineral buildup.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age to your trim and baseboards. Check for signs of bubbling or peeling and address the issue quickly.
Unpleasant Sounds or Creaks
Unpleasant sounds or creaks from your trim and baseboards can show water damage. Check for signs of loose or damaged boards and address the issue quickly.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age to your trim and baseboards can be a sign of a larger issue. Check for signs of water pooling or damage to surrounding areas.

Q: How long does Trim & Baseboard Replacement After Water Damage take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ete Trim & Baseboard Replacement After Water Damage dep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, it takes 2-5 days to complete the job. But, in some cases, it may take longer.
Q: Do I need to replace all of my trim and baseboards?
A: Not always. Only the damaged areas need to be replaced and we’ll work with you to find out the best course of action. In some cases, we may be able to repair or refinish damaged trim and baseboards.
